Description:

THE CANDIDATE MUST HAVE SIGNIFICANT EXPERIENCE IN LEADING MASTER DATA MANAGEMENT (MDM) PREFERABLY WITHIN THE CUSTOMER MASTERING DOMAIN.

Your key responsibilities include:

  • Develop, maintain and communicate high level plans for investing in the IT environment/ infrastructure, for allocated portfolio to ensure effective architecture strategy is developed and maintained.
  • Manage architecture development and governance processes for allocated portfolio to promote effective governance and solution quality within architecture.
  • Ensure solution architecture aligns with roadmaps established by the enterprise architecture and adhere to enterprise architecture principles.
  • Convert requirements into the architecture and design that make up the blueprint for the solution, balancing architectural concerns of the projects with the concerns of the enterprise.
  • Lead the development of solutions for allocated portfolio to ensure effective solutions are designed in accordance with business requirements, Westpac Group standards and IT Strategy.
  • Build and apply knowledge of emerging technologies and take a continuous improvement approach to ensure Westpac remains innovative and up to date with market leading technologies and industry trends.
  • Develop and influence relationships to ensure appropriate stakeholders are effectively engaged in the alignment to Enterprise Architecture’s direction.
  • Promote the solutions architecture process, outcomes and value proposition to the organisation.
  • Influence and ensure buy-in from the development team so that the detailed design of the solution aligns to the higher-level architecture.
  • Provide leadership to a small, professional team of Solution Architects, creating clear line of sight and accountability, maximising employee performance and engagement.
